BMW Battery Replacement - How to Do it Yourself
If your BMW key fob isn't responding to your locks and unlock buttons or has stopped working altogether It's likely that it needs a new battery. It's easy to replace the battery yourself.
You simply need to locate the access port hidden inside the valet key, remove it, and then replace the battery and replace it with a new one. Then, you must register the new battery.

How to replace a CR2450 battery
The BMW key fob is a vital part of your driving experience, offering security and convenience with the click of a button. Over time, however the battery in your BMW key fob will be damaged, and need to be replaced in order for it to continue working properly. Knowing how to replace the BMW key fob battery will allow you to get back on the road quickly and quickly.
While there are several different types of BMW key fobs, the majority of them utilize the same type of battery that is a CR2450 or CR2032 coin cell. This small, round battery can be often found in shops and can be bought for less than a dollar per unit. In addition to being readily available, CR2450 batteries are also very simple to install and take off from the key fob.
To replace the CR2450 batteries in your BMW look for the tab that releases the metal valet within the fob. After the metal valet has been removed, you can locate the tiny access port that hides the key battery on the front of the fob. Remove the cover using a flat-headed screwdriver, revealing the battery. Replace the battery with the positive side facing upwards and then reassemble the key fob.
After the new battery has been installed After the battery is installed, test the key fob to ensure that it functions correctly. If the key fob still isn't responding, contact your BMW dealer for further troubleshooting assistance. Certain older BMW models require that the key fob is synchronized with the vehicle after changing the battery. However, this is not the case for BMWs made in recent years.
Although it is possible to replace the battery on an older BMW key fob by cutting the case and soldering to a new battery, this method is not recommended as it could damage the internal circuit board.
